Makita DJR183Z Information

The Makita DJR183Z is a 18V LXT cordless reciprocating saw that is perfect for a variety of cutting tasks. It features a powerful motor that delivers up to 3,000 SPM, a 13mm stroke length, and a cutting capacity of 50mm in wood. The saw also has two switch levers for added control, as well as a low vibration design for comfort.

Safety Information

  • Read all safety warnings and all instructions. Failure to follow the warnings and instructions may result in electric shock, fire and/or serious injury. Save all warnings and instructions for future reference.
  • The term "power tool" in the warnings refers to your mains-operated (corded) power tool or battery-operated (cordless) power tool.
  • Do not use the power tool in a potentially explosive atmosphere. The power tool sparks could ignite fumes.
  • Keep children and bystanders away from the work area. Distractions can cause you to lose control of the power tool.
  • Dress properly. Do not wear loose clothing or jewelry. Keep your hair, clothing and gloves away from moving parts.
  • Use safety glasses. Also use face shield or safety goggles if operating in dusty areas.
  • Wear ear protection to protect your hearing.
  • Use only accessories that are recommended by the manufacturer for your specific power tool. Use of improper accessories may result in serious personal injury.
  • Do not force the power tool. Use the correct power tool for your application. The correct power tool will do the job better and safer at the rate for which it was designed.
  • Do not use the power tool if it is damaged. Have the power tool repaired by a qualified person before use.
  • Keep cutting tools sharp and clean. Properly sharpened cutting tools with a clean cutting edge are less likely to bind and are easier to control.
  • Use the power tool and accessories in accordance with these instructions, taking into account the working conditions and the work to be done.
  • Stop the power tool if the trigger is accidentally depressed.
  • Disconnect the plug from the mains outlet or remove the battery pack from the power tool before making any adjustments, changing accessories, or storing the power tool. Such preventive safety measures reduce the risk of starting the power tool accidentally.
  • Store the power tool when it is not in use in a dry, locked-up place out of the reach of children.
